A few years ago in the Vintage Ford tech tips section by Milt Webb he talked about on Mag coil systems, position #1 3/32" past TDC (power stroke). Turn the key on and the #1 coil should start to buzz with spark lever retarded (up).
He went on to explain non buzzing coil @ that timing position and corrections to shorten or lengthen the spark rod based on "start buzz" point.
So instead of pulling a spark plug and using a screw driver atop the piston to locate TDC I came up with this.
I figured as I had the head off to mark the crankshaft (blue dot) second picture @ TDC power stroke after setting dial indicator to zero in first picture and approx 3/32" past TDC about .0937 third picture and marking crankshaft again with (black dot), Fourth picture.
I can transpose those marks to the new crankshaft pulley for future reference.
